Cost of House Plumbing Repair in Hendersonville

Zip

The cost of house plumbing repair in Hendersonville, TN can vary significantly depending on the nature and scope of the work required. Whether you're dealing with a minor leak or a major pipe replacement, understanding the factors that influence these costs can help you budget more effectively and avoid unexpected expenses.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Type of Repair: Simple fixes like unclogging a drain are generally less expensive than major tasks like sewer line replacements.
  • Materials Needed: The cost can vary based on the quality and type of materials used, such as PVC, copper, or PEX piping.
  • Labor Rates: Labor costs can differ depending on the plumber’s experience and the complexity of the job.
  • Location of the Problem: Repairs that are hard to access, such as those behind walls or under floors, can be more expensive.
  • Emergency Services: Urgent repairs, especially those needed outside of regular business hours, typically incur higher charges.
  • Permits and Inspections: Some plumbing work may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.

Common Tasks and Costs

Task Average Cost (Hendersonville, TN)
Unclogging a Drain $100 - $250
Fixing a Leaky Faucet $150 - $300
Toilet Repair $125 - $275
Water Heater Repair $200 - $500
Pipe Repair $150 - $400 per section
Sewer Line Replacement $3,000 - $6,000
Installing New Fixtures $200 - $600 per fixture
Garbage Disposal Repair $100 - $250
Sump Pump Installation $800 - $1,500
Main Water Line Repair $500 - $2,000

Understanding these costs can help you plan for any plumbing issues that may arise, ensuring you're prepared both financially and logistically.
